Primary Purpose: This position will assist individual students and small groups in academic content areas as needed. Under the direct supervision of a certified teacher.
Qualifications: Education/Certification:
- High School Diploma or GED and
- Forty-eight semester college hours from an accredited college; or passed the TABE test or received the Region 20 - Treasuring Our Paraprofessionals Certificate
- Be eligible to obtain a paraprofessional certificate issued by the State Board of Educator Certification
Major Responsibilities and Duties:
- Assist in maintaining student records and provide feedback as requested by teacher
- Conduct instructional activities outlined by the teacher and work with students to develop skills
- Assist with supervision of students, instruction or activities that may fall within or outside the classroom environment
- Assist with maintaining a safe, neat and orderly classroom
- Follow District guidelines in maintaining classroom management, discipline and confidentiality
- Provide orientation and assistance to substitute teachers
- Participate in required staff development, faculty meetings, special events and District sponsored activities
- Assist with the preparation of instructional materials and classroom displays
- Assist students with reading, writing, testing or any other preparation or activities
- Performs other duties as assigned
Mental/Physical/Environmental Factors:
- Lifts/Carries 10-25 pounds frequently, 25-40 pounds occasionally, more than 45 pounds infrequently with assistance
- Pushing/Pulling 10-35 pounds sporadically
- Maintain emotional control under stress
- Continual walking, standing, stooping, kneeling, bending, and twisting
- Work indoors and outdoors in varying climate conditions
- May be required under specific circumstances to provide physical restraint of students in danger of causing harm to themselves or others
